Infrastructure and Large-Scale Public Projects
One of the most common usage areas of stationary concrete batching plants is in infrastructure development. These plants are frequently used in the construction of highways, bridges, tunnels, and dams. Due to their ability to produce large volumes of concrete with consistent quality, they are particularly suitable for government-funded public works and mega infrastructure projects where continuity and durability are essential.
For example, in the construction of a highway network, a reliable concrete supply is crucial to maintaining progress and meeting deadlines. Stationary batching plants, with their high automation and storage capabilities, ensure uninterrupted operation throughout the entire construction process.
Commercial and Industrial Construction
Another significant area where stationary concrete batching plants are widely used is in commercial and industrial construction. High-rise buildings, shopping malls, factories, and warehouses often require a large amount of concrete over a fixed timeline. These projects benefit greatly from the plant’s ability to deliver consistent mixes in large quantities without delays.
In industrial applications, concrete often needs to meet specific standards or technical specifications. Stationary batching plants, equipped with advanced control systems and precision weighing mechanisms, allow producers to fine-tune their mix designs to meet even the strictest requirements. This level of control is especially important in projects where safety and load-bearing performance are non-negotiable.
Additional Applications and Benefits
Besides infrastructure and commercial uses, stationary concrete batching plants are also employed in the production of precast concrete elements. Items such as pipes, beams, wall panels, and foundation blocks are often manufactured in controlled environments using concrete from these batching systems. Since the plant remains fixed in one location, it allows for stable, high-quality output suitable for prefabrication processes.
